Rosario+Vampire Manga
 
http://img519.imageshack.us/img519/4402/001jz1.jpg

Shounen manga serialized in Jump by IKEDA Akihisa.

Synopsis from mangaupdates:

By a bizzare coincidence, Tsukune Aono has accidentally gotten himself admitted to a youkai acadamy, a school attended by monsters (youkai). Just when he thinks he'll run away from there, he meets the beautiful girl Moka and his mood turns ultra happy. However, she transforms into her true form when the rosary on her chest is taken off, she's a super vampire!

It is not a sequel per se; R+V's new arc is only named Season II because the series had to switch magazines when Monthly Shonen Jump was put out of service and thankfully replaced by Jump Square SQ. S2 simply picks up where S1 left off; I doubt we'll even see mention of S2 anywhere in the volumes as it is of no consquence to the publishing/printing companies...
